
在Excel中设置进度条的方法有多种,主要包括:条件格式、数据条和VBA宏。 其中,条件格式是最常用的方法,可以通过简单的步骤实现直观的进度条效果。下面将详细介绍如何使用条件格式设置进度条。
一、使用条件格式设置进度条
条件格式是一种在Excel中根据单元格的值自动应用格式的功能。通过条件格式,我们可以创建动态的进度条。
1、准备数据
首先,确保你的数据是适合用进度条表示的。例如,假设你有一列数据表示任务的完成百分比(0%到100%)。
任务 进度
任务1 30%
任务2 70%
任务3 50%
2、选择数据范围
选择你要应用进度条的单元格范围。在本例中,选择“进度”列中的所有单元格。
3、应用条件格式
- 在Excel中,选择“开始”选项卡。
- 点击“条件格式”按钮。
- 从下拉菜单中选择“数据条”。
- 选择一个你喜欢的样式(如渐变填充或实心填充)。
这样,Excel会根据每个单元格中的数值自动生成相应长度的进度条。
4、微调设置
你可以进一步微调进度条的外观:
- 再次点击“条件格式”按钮。
- 选择“管理规则”。
- 在条件格式规则管理器中,选择“编辑规则”。
- 在编辑规则对话框中,你可以调整最小值和最大值,或更改填充颜色和边框样式。
二、使用数据条设置进度条
使用Excel内置的数据条功能,可以快速直观地展示数据的大小和进度。
1、选择数据范围
和前面的方法一样,首先选择你要应用进度条的单元格范围。
2、应用数据条
- 在Excel中,选择“开始”选项卡。
- 点击“条件格式”按钮。
- 从下拉菜单中选择“数据条”。
- 选择一个你喜欢的样式。
数据条会根据单元格中的数值自动生成,并显示在单元格的背景中。
3、调整数据条格式
- 再次点击“条件格式”按钮。
- 选择“管理规则”。
- 在条件格式规则管理器中,选择“编辑规则”。
- 在编辑规则对话框中,你可以调整数据条的最小值和最大值,或更改数据条的颜色和外观。
三、使用VBA宏创建进度条
对于高级用户,可以使用VBA宏来创建更复杂和定制化的进度条。
1、打开VBA编辑器
按“Alt + F11”打开VBA编辑器。
2、插入模块
在VBA编辑器中,插入一个新的模块。
3、编写宏代码
在模块中,输入以下代码:
Sub CreateProgressBar()
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ets("Sheet1")
Dim cell As Range
For Each cell In ws.Range("B2:B10")
Dim progress As Double
progress = cell.Value
cell.Offset(0, 1).Value = String(progress * 20, "|")
Next cell
End Sub
这个宏会根据“进度”列中的值生成进度条,并在相邻的单元格中显示。
4、运行宏
按“F5”运行宏,或者在Excel中,按“Alt + F8”选择并运行宏。
四、使用图表创建进度条
通过图表也可以创建更加直观和美观的进度条。
1、准备数据
确保你的数据是适合用图表表示的。例如:
任务 完成 未完成
任务1 30% 70%
任务2 70% 30%
任务3 50% 50%
2、插入堆积条形图
- 选择你的数据范围。
- 在Excel中,选择“插入”选项卡。
- 选择“堆积条形图”。
3、调整图表格式
- 选择图表中的数据系列。
- 右键点击,选择“设置数据系列格式”。
- 调整数据系列的颜色、边框和间距,使图表看起来像进度条。
五、使用条件格式的图标集
Excel中的图标集也是一种直观的进度展示方法。
1、选择数据范围
选择你要应用图标集的单元格范围。
2、应用图标集
- 在Excel中,选择“开始”选项卡。
- 点击“条件格式”按钮。
- 从下拉菜单中选择“图标集”。
- 选择一个你喜欢的图标样式(如信号灯、箭头等)。
3、调整图标集设置
- 再次点击“条件格式”按钮。
- 选择“管理规则”。
- 在条件格式规则管理器中,选择“编辑规则”。
- 在编辑规则对话框中,你可以设置每个图标对应的数值范围,或更改图标的显示方式。
六、使用进度条模板
如果你不想手动设置进度条,可以使用现成的Excel进度条模板。
1、下载模板
在互联网上搜索并下载适合你的Excel进度条模板。
2、导入模板
打开下载的模板文件,将其内容复制粘贴到你的工作簿中,或直接在模板中输入你的数据。
七、进度条的应用场景
进度条在项目管理、任务跟踪、绩效评估等多个领域都有广泛的应用。
1、项目管理
在项目管理中,进度条可以直观地展示项目的完成情况,帮助项目经理及时掌握项目进展。
2、任务跟踪
在日常工作中,使用进度条可以有效地跟踪任务的完成情况,提高工作效率。
3、绩效评估
在绩效评估中,进度条可以清晰地展示员工的工作成果,帮助管理者做出公正的评价。
八、进度条的优缺点
1、优点
- 直观易懂:进度条通过视觉效果展示数据,易于理解。
- 动态更新:数据变化时,进度条会自动更新。
- 多样化:可以通过不同的方法和样式创建进度条,满足不同需求。
2、缺点
- 设置复杂:对于新手来说,设置进度条可能比较复杂。
- 性能影响:大量使用条件格式和图表可能影响Excel的性能。
- 定制化受限:虽然可以通过VBA宏实现高级功能,但需要编程知识。
九、进度条的优化技巧
1、简化数据
确保数据格式简单明了,避免复杂的计算和嵌套公式。
2、减少条件格式
尽量减少使用条件格式的单元格数量,以提高Excel的性能。
3、使用图表替代
在可能的情况下,使用图表替代条件格式,可以获得更好的视觉效果和性能。
十、总结
在Excel中设置进度条的方法有多种,主要包括条件格式、数据条和VBA宏。 其中,条件格式是最常用的方法,可以通过简单的步骤实现直观的进度条效果。通过上述方法,你可以根据实际需求选择合适的进度条设置方式,提高工作效率和数据展示效果。
希望本文对你在Excel中设置进度条有所帮助。如果你有更多的问题或需求,欢迎在评论区留言讨论。
相关问答FAQs:
1. 如何在Excel中创建一个进度条?
- 在Excel中,可以使用条件格式来创建一个进度条。首先,选择要创建进度条的单元格或单元格范围。然后,打开“开始”选项卡,点击“条件格式”按钮,选择“数据条”选项。在弹出的菜单中,选择“进度条”样式,并根据需要调整颜色和其他样式选项。
2. 如何根据数值自动更新Excel中的进度条?
- 若要根据数值自动更新进度条,可以使用公式和条件格式。首先,在一个单元格中输入表示进度的数值,例如0到100之间的数字。然后,选择要应用条件格式的单元格或单元格范围。在条件格式中,选择“使用公式确定要设置的单元格格式”选项,并输入一个公式,如:
=A1/100,其中A1是包含进度数值的单元格。然后,选择进度条样式,并应用到单元格或单元格范围。
3. 如何在Excel中显示具有不同颜色的进度条?
- 如果要在Excel中显示具有不同颜色的进度条,可以使用条件格式和数据条。首先,选择要创建进度条的单元格或单元格范围。然后,打开“开始”选项卡,点击“条件格式”按钮,选择“数据条”选项。在弹出的菜单中,选择“更多规则”,然后在“格式值”下拉菜单中选择“百分比”。在“最小值”和“最大值”字段中,分别设置要显示的进度范围的最小和最大值。接下来,为每个进度范围选择不同的颜色和样式,并应用到单元格或单元格范围。这样,不同进度范围的进度条就会显示不同的颜色。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4893254